Accounts Payable Coordinator
Fender Musical Instruments Corporation is a world famous brand with offices across the globe. Within Fender Musical Instruments Corporation’s ("FMIC") Accounts Payable team, we proudly process a large volume of complex invoices from domestic and international vendors in a highly automated environment, using the latest AP processing technologies.
An American icon, Fender was born in Southern California and has built a worldwide influence extending beyond the studio and the stage. A Fender is more than an instrument, it’s a cultural symbol that resonates globally.
We are searching for an Accounts Payable Coordinator to join our team in Scottsdale, AZ . This entry-level role offers tremendous growth potential for early career professionals interested in finance and accounting. The AP Coordinator will assist with processing vendor payments, processing vendor invoices in a highly automated environment, resolving discrepancies, responding to inquiries, maintaining records and documentation, and supporting the AP team with various administrative tasks to ensure smooth financial operations. This position offers an excellent opportunity for professional development and advancement within our Finance-Accounting department at Fender.
This is a hybrid role based out of Scottsdale, AZ.
Essential Functions:
- Process Vendor invoices with varying degrees of complexity
- Maintain organized digital and physical filing systems for AP documentation
- Support the team with basic invoice research and discrepancy resolution
- Route invoices through appropriate approval workflows
- Communicate with internal departments to gather missing information
- Assist with data entry and basic reporting tasks
- Support the accounts payable team with administrative duties as needed
- Learn and follow department best practices and procedures
- Participate in process improvement efforts
- Other tasks, as assigned
Qualifications:
- Associate's degree in Accounting, Finance, Business, or related field; Bachelor's degree preferred but not required
- 1-2 years of office/administrative experience (accounting experience a plus)
- Strong math skills and basic understanding of accounting principles preferred
- Strong attention to detail and commitment to accuracy
-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ook)
- Excellent organizational skills and ability to manage multiple priorities
- Effective written and verbal communication skills
- Problem-solving and critical thinking abilities
- Collaborative team player with a positive attitude and willingness to learn
- Ability to multi-task, prioritize, and adapt to a fast-paced environment
- Desire to grow within the finance/accounting field
About Fender Musical Instruments:
Fender Musical Instruments Corporation (FMIC) is one of the world’s leading musical instrument manufacturers, marketers and distributors, whose portfolio of brands includes Fender®, Squier®, Presonus®, Gretsch®, Jackson®, EVH®, Charvel®, Bigsby®, and Groove Tubes®, among others.
